To get to Gluepot Reserve from Waikerie, cross the 24-hour car ferry,and follow the Taylorville Road for 10 km to the intersection of the Goyder Highway. Turn left onto the Goyder Highway for 3 km until the right hand turn onto Lunn Road. Lunn Road and beyond into the Reserve is about 50 km and is unsealed.

  • Lunn Road is the only route by which you can access Gluepot Reserve. All other ways lead to locked gates. Electronic satellite navigation systems and other mapping services such as Google Maps may lead you astray.
  • If travelling on the Goyder Highway from Morgan, the Lunn Road turnoff is a distance of 31 km.
  • If travelling on the Goyder Highway from Renmark, the Lunn Road turnoff is a distance of 83 km.
  • When dry, tracks are usually suitable for 2WD and medium caravans. After approximately 15 mm of rain they may be closed or affected by water and suitable for 4WD only. Phone 8892 8600 for advice
    after rain.
  • Visitors are advised that they will travel through private property before reaching the Gluepot
    boundary. You should avoid stopping, and under no circumstances camp. Please be aware of the possible presence of kangaroos, cattle, or other feral animals and drive accordingly. All gates should be left as found.
  • There are no fires permitted on Gluepot Reserve, except for gas fires (these may also be banned on a total fire ban days). Pets and firearms are also not permitted.
